Meaning & Origin of Nathan

Nathan is a Hebrew name meaning "he gave" or "gift of God," derived from the verb "natan" (to give). In the Bible, Nathan was a prophet who served as an advisor to King David and played a crucial role in ensuring Solomon's succession to the throne. The name has been used continuously in Jewish and Christian communities for millennia. Nathan has remained steadily popular in the English-speaking world since the 17th century, valued for its strong biblical heritage and straightforward, masculine sound.

Famous People Named Nathan

  • Nathan Hale — American Revolutionary War hero and spy
  • Nathan Lane — American actor known for The Birdcage and Broadway
  • Nathan Chen — American Olympic gold medal figure skater
